Su-8 bonding clogging problem
Jiang Ziling
2005-04-14
hi all,

  I tried to make channel by bonding two Glass wafers, one with a 50um
exposed Su-8 layer with channel on it, another with a 50um unexposed
Su-8 layer. According to some research, at 75 degree centigrade the
unexposed Su-8 can reform shape and bond with the exposed layer when
certain pressure is applied. But I tested and found that the 100um
wide channels on the exposed su-8 surface are always clogged by the
soft Su-8 flowing from the unexposed layer during pressing-bonding.
However, if I don't press, there will be no bonding. Does anyone have
experience in solving this clogging problem?
